1. Specifications Comparison
| Feature | Samsung Galaxy Tab S9 FE | Asus ROG Phone 8 Pro | Practical Impact |
|---|---|---|---|
| Design | |||
| Dimensions | 254.3 x 165.8 x 6.5 mm | 163.8 x 76.8 x 8.9 mm | Tab S9 FE significantly larger; ROG Phone 8 Pro more pocketable. |
| Weight | 523g | 225g | Tab S9 FE much heavier, impacting portability for extended use. |
| Display | |||
| Size | 10.9" | 6.78" | Tab S9 FE better for media consumption and multitasking; ROG Phone 8 Pro more one-hand friendly. |
| Type | IPS LCD, 90Hz | LTPO AMOLED, 1B colors, 165Hz, HDR10+ | ROG Phone 8 Pro offers superior color accuracy, contrast, smoothness, and brightness. Tab S9 FE uses a power-efficient but less visually impressive panel. |
| Resolution | 1440 x 2304 | 1080 x 2400 | Similar pixel density despite resolution difference due to screen size; both sharp but Tab S9 FE slightly sharper due to higher PPI. |
| Refresh Rate | 90Hz | 165Hz | ROG Phone 8 Pro offers significantly smoother scrolling and animations, especially noticeable in gaming. |
| Peak Brightness | Not specified | 2500 nits | ROG Phone 8 Pro offers exceptional outdoor visibility; unclear how Tab S9 FE performs in bright sunlight. |
| Performance | |||
| Chipset | Exynos 1380 (5nm) | Snapdragon 8 Gen 3 (4nm) | ROG Phone 8 Pro significantly more powerful, enabling smoother multitasking, demanding gaming, and faster app loading. |
| CPU | Octa-core (4x2.4 GHz A78 & 4x2.0 GHz A55) | Octa-core (1x3.3 GHz X4 & 3x3.2 GHz A720 & 2x3.0 GHz A720 & 2x2.3 GHz A520) | ROG Phone 8 Pro boasts a newer, more powerful CPU architecture. |
| GPU | Mali-G68 MP5 | Adreno 750 | ROG Phone 8 Pro has a considerably more powerful GPU, ideal for high-end gaming and graphics-intensive tasks. |
| RAM/Storage | 8GB/256GB | 24GB/1TB | ROG Phone 8 Pro provides significantly more RAM and storage for smoother multitasking and ample space for files and apps. |
| Battery | |||
| Capacity | 8000 mAh | 5500 mAh | Tab S9 FE offers a larger battery capacity, potentially lasting longer despite the larger display. Real-world battery life depends on usage patterns and software optimization. |
| Other | |||
| OS | Android 13 | Android 14 | Both run recent Android versions; minor feature differences expected. ROG Phone likely to receive longer software support given its gaming focus. |
| NFC | No | Yes | ROG Phone 8 Pro supports contactless payments and data transfer via NFC. |
2. Key Differences Analysis
Samsung Galaxy Tab S9 FE Advantages:
- Larger Display: Better for media consumption, multitasking, and productivity.
- Potentially Longer Battery Life: Larger battery capacity might offset larger display consumption.
Asus ROG Phone 8 Pro Advantages:
- Significantly More Powerful: Superior CPU, GPU, and RAM for demanding tasks and gaming.
- Superior Display Quality: AMOLED with higher refresh rate, brightness, and color accuracy.
- More Compact and Lighter: Easier to hold and carry.
- More Storage: 1TB offers ample space for apps, games, and files.
Trade-offs:
- Tab S9 FE: Less powerful, lower display quality, heavier and less portable.
- ROG Phone 8 Pro: Smaller display, smaller battery, likely higher price.
